As a child, Alethia Wallen had a strong interest in heat, fire, and static shock; she also preferred remote-control vehicles over dolls.

“I always loved to take my father’s tools and disassemble electronics around the house, much to my parents’ dismay,” she says. “As I got older, I turned to psychology, but my interest in the invisible particles that power society never disappeared.”

When she was in between jobs, her cousin suggested that she give the electrical trade a try.

“I researched the company he worked for and the electrical trade as a whole, and I was really excited about the thought of a clear career path in which I can use my mental and physical abilities without being behind a desk or in sales,” she says.

She started her journey in the electrical trade with Encore Electric in their prefabrication warehouse in Colorado and never looked back. Now at 5 Points Electrical, she has led commercial and residential projects as a field leader. She currently helps manage the Fulton County Government renovation project in the heart of Atlanta. Because all the construction work is done at night, she tries her best to be available — even if it is late in the evening.

“The success of the project is more important than a few minutes of sleep,” she says.

Along with focusing on her day-to-day job, she is working to achieve project manager status, complete her engineering degree and the PMI certification, and obtain a master electrician license. She says she is honored to be selected as one of EC&M’s 30 Under 30 recipients.

“I can truly say that this is the best and most forward-thinking company I have been a part of, and I look forward to continuing my journey with it,” she says.
